Is It Normal For Dialysis Patients Not To Urine? A person with healthy kidneys may urinate up to seven times a day. Most people on dialysis; however, make little to no urine, because their kidneys are no longer properly removing wastes and extra fluid from the body. Do dialysis patients still urinate? As a result

How Long Can You Live On Dialysis Without A Kidney Transplant? Life expectancy on dialysis can vary depending on your other medical conditions and how well you follow your treatment plan. Average life expectancy on dialysis is 5-10 years, however, many patients have lived well on dialysis for 20 or even 30 years. What percentage

How Do You Stop Cramps From Dialysis? Avoiding/easing muscle cramps pain during dialysis: • Low intensity exercise (e.g. stationary bike) during dialysis. Minimize intra-dialytic weight gain. Minimize dialysis related hypotension. Consider higher dialysate sodium concentration (sodium ramping). How do you stop cramps after dialysis? Muscle cramps can be treated by isotonic-hypertonic saline or hypertonic dextrose
